File disclosure via symlink-swap archive race

Published Nov 20, 2025 · Updated Nov 21, 2025

Path allowlist bypass in Open OnDemand before 3.1.16 or 4.0.8 allows remote authenticated users to read unauthorized server files. PosixFile validates every directory entry before archiving begins, but FilesController later dereferences a user-swapped symlink without rechecking its target against OOD_ALLOWLIST_PATH. The flaw requires the file-browser allowlist and directory downloads; the attacker can read only files permitted by the attacker's UNIX account.
